Episode 3: The Forgotten Library
The next evening, Sora stood in front of the abandoned university library, gripping the black rose tightly.
It had been years since anyone had stepped inside. The grand structure, once a symbol of knowledge and curiosity, now stood forgotten, covered in vines and shadows. The "No Trespassing" sign swung slightly in the cool night breeze, but Sora ignored it.
Her eyes flickered down to the note tied to the rose.
"Find me."
Raven’s handwriting.
She swallowed hard. Could he really be here? Was this some cruel joke?
Taking a deep breath, she pushed open the rusted gate. It groaned in protest, sending a chill down her spine. Every instinct told her to turn back, to leave this place behind—but something stronger pulled her forward.
The library doors were slightly ajar. A cold draft slipped through the gap, carrying the scent of aged paper and dust. She stepped inside, her footsteps echoing in the silence.
Inside, the library felt frozen in time. Rows of forgotten bookshelves stretched into the darkness, their spines coated in years of neglect. A broken chandelier hung overhead, its crystals catching faint moonlight. The reading tables were coated in dust, untouched.
Memories flooded back.
She had spent countless nights here with Raven, whispering secrets between the shelves, laughing over mystery novels, dreaming about the future. But the last time she had been here… he had vanished.
Her heart clenched.
She wasn’t here for nostalgia. She was here for answers.
That’s when she noticed it—a flickering candle on the center table.
Sora’s breath hitched.
Someone had been here recently.
She moved closer, her hands trembling. Beside the candle lay a stack of old, yellowed papers. The handwriting was unmistakable.
Raven’s.
She hesitated before picking up the top page. The ink was slightly smudged, but the words sent a shiver through her spine:
"If you're reading this, it means you're searching for me. But some things are better left in the dark."
Her fingers curled around the paper.
The next sheet wasn’t a letter—it was a drawing.
A woman.
Long, flowing hair. Eyes filled with sorrow.
Sora’s chest tightened. She knew this face.
But from where?
She flipped to the final page. Unlike the others, it contained just one word.
"RUN."
The candle’s flame flickered violently, as if responding to the message.
Then—
A thud.
A heavy, unmistakable sound from the upper floor.
Sora’s breath caught. Her body went rigid.
Someone was here.
Slowly, she tilted her head upward, toward the spiral staircase leading to the second level.
The shadows shifted.
Her blood ran cold. A figure stood at the top of the stairs, barely visible in the dim light.
Sora’s heart pounded against her ribs.
She took a step back.
The floor creaked beneath her feet.
The figure moved.
A surge of panic gripped her, but she forced herself to stay rooted. She needed to see, to know who it was.
Then—
A whisper.
Soft. Close.
"You shouldn't have come, Sora."
Her breath hitched.
She spun around, eyes darting through the darkness.
But no one was there.
Only the candle remained, flickering wildly as if mocking her fear.
Her grip on the papers tightened.
Someone wanted her to run.
But she wasn’t leaving until she uncovered the truth.
Even if it meant facing the ghosts of her past.
